What is a basement assessment?  I read an article that said it is the only way we can purchase basement insurance.

A basement assessment is a new method of strengthening a basement’s walls before it starts leaking. Once the walls are treated they only have a small chance of leaking for fifteen to twenty years. It is correct that we have heard some insurance companies are offering basement insurance against the walls leaking afterwards. Usually you will find more basement companies providing the insurance themselves for a couple hundred a year. What is good about having an assessment done is the insurance fills in the gap between regular insurance and flood insurance. Regular insurance doesn’t cover floods, and poor foundation walls are not automatically covered.  Many inspectors in the South barely look at basement walls when they inspect a home with a basement.  That means the homeowner never discovers a problem until the walls have bowed and sometimes collapsed, which is really too late to do anything about it.
